The article provides a review of modern methods of morphological ambiguity resolution. We considered such methods as statistical disambiguation, Brill’s automatically generated rules, decision trees and their modifications. For the comparison, the article provides numerical results obtained on two open corpora: OpenCorpora and SynTagRus. ...

Recurrent neural networks have proved to be an effective method for statistical language modeling. However, in practice their memory and run-time complexity are usually too large to be implemented in real-time offline mobile applications. In this paper we consider several compression techniques for recurrent neural networks including Long–Short Term Memory models. We make particular attention ...
